Unable to hold on to happiness, son-in-law seeks father-in-law's life
Filled with resentment because he thought his father-in-law supported his daughter's divorce, Lieu took a knife to his father-in-law's house and killed him.
The Hanoi People's Court recently brought defendant Nguyen Nhu Lieu (born in 1985, in Ha Dong, Hanoi) to trial for murder. Lieu's victim was his father-in-law.
Lieu and Ms. Nguyen Thi Le Hang (born in 1994, in Ha Dong, Hanoi) got married and had 2 children together. According to Ms. Hang, her marriage with her husband was not peaceful as the two often had conflicts.

In early 2016, Ms. Hang and her husband filed for divorce at the Ha Dong District People's Court. While waiting for the court to resolve the divorce, Ms. Hang took her children to live with her parents, Mr. Nguyen Dinh Manh (born in 1970) and Ms. Dao Thi Hong (born in 1972), in Dong Mai (Ha Dong, Hanoi).
Since then, Lieu and Mr. Manh's family have argued many times. Once, Lieu even threatened to hit his father-in-law with a knife.
On the evening of September 4, 2016, Lieu's family invited his siblings and children home for dinner, and Lieu also picked up his daughter. After eating, Lieu drove his daughter back to his father-in-law's house. He did not go inside the house, but dropped the children off at the end of the alley and then drove away.
Killing father-in-law
That day, angry that Mr. Manh supported his daughter's divorce, Lieu had the idea of beating Mr. Manh to vent his anger. He took a machete and returned to his father-in-law's house.
When they arrived, they saw that the gate was locked and the lights were still on inside the house. Lieu climbed over the fence into Mr. Manh's yard. At that time, Mrs. Hong was in the living room on the first floor. Hearing the sound of a motorbike, she opened the door and looked out. Seeing Lieu climb over the wall into the yard, knowing that something was wrong, Mrs. Hong woke up her husband.
Mr. Manh's son, Nguyen Dinh Huy (born in 1996), saw Lieu in the yard and asked: "What are you doing here?" Lieu replied: "You already know, why are you asking?" Then he rushed into the living room door and headed towards the bedroom door. At this time, Mr. Manh came out of the room, holding an iron pipe in his hand.
As soon as he saw his father-in-law, Lieu rushed in and swung his knife, slashing the victim in the chest. Mr. Manh only had time to shout, "He slashed me," and rushed to hug Lieu. The two men pushed each other through the side door and fell onto the brick floor.
At this time, Huy ran out and saw Lieu lying on his back, Mr. Manh lying on top, Lieu still holding a knife in his hand, Huy holding a mop and hitting Lieu repeatedly.
When the mop broke, Huy grabbed a nearby cleaver and slashed Lieu's right hand 2-3 times. Lieu tried to raise her arms to cover her head and pull her legs up, but Huy slashed her legs 1-2 more times.
Seeing that, Mr. Manh said to his son: "Okay, take me to the emergency room." Mr. Manh was taken to the emergency room but died that night due to irreversible blood loss.
Lieu was also injured and was taken to the emergency room by his family. On September 14, 2016, when he was discharged from the hospital, he turned himself in.
Regarding Nguyen Dinh Huy, the investigation agency said that when he witnessed his brother-in-law storming into the house with a knife to slash his father, Huy used a mop and a knife to slash Lieu's arms and legs, causing 10% injury. Huy beat his brother-in-law to prevent Lieu from attacking Mr. Manh.
After seeing Lieu drop the knife and lie still, Huy did not attack Lieu anymore. Huy's actions were considered a case of legitimate self-defense, as stipulated in Article 15 of the Penal Code, so the Investigation Police did not mention any action against Huy.
Present in court, the defendant's wife said that she and her husband often argued about money. "Both my children depend on their parents. Whenever my husband runs out of money, he comes home and causes trouble with his wife and children," said Ms. Hang.
As for the defendant, he denied his statement to the police, saying that he did not intend to kill his father-in-law. In his final words, the defendant apologized to both his paternal and maternal families, hoping for leniency from the law.
After consideration, the panel of judges on December 14 sentenced the defendant to life in prison.
